using System.Globalization;
using System.IO.Pipelines;
using Npgsql;
using NpgsqlRest;
using NpgsqlRest.TableFormatHandlers;
using SpreadCheetah;
using SpreadCheetah.Styling;
namespace NpgsqlRestClient;
public class ExcelTableFormatHandler : ITableFormatHandler
{
public string ContentType => "application/vnd.openxmlformats-officedocument.spreadsheetml.sheet";
/// <summary>
/// Worksheet name. When null, uses the routine name.
/// </summary>
public string? SheetName { get; set; } = null;
/// <summary>
/// Excel Format Code for DateTime cells. When null, uses SpreadCheetah default (yyyy-MM-dd HH:mm:ss).
/// Uses Excel Format Codes (not .NET format strings). Examples: "yyyy-mm-dd", "dd/mm/yyyy hh:mm".
/// </summary>
public string? DateTimeFormat { get; set; } = null;
/// <summary>
/// Excel Format Code for numeric cells. When null, uses Excel default (General).
/// Uses Excel Format Codes (not .NET format strings). Examples: "#,##0.00", "0.00", "#,##0".
/// </summary>
public string? NumericFormat { get; set; } = null;
public async Task RenderAsync(
NpgsqlDataReader reader,
Routine routine,
RoutineEndpoint endpoint,
PipeWriter writer,
HttpContext context,
ulong bufferRows,
Dictionary<string, string>? customParameters,
CancellationToken cancellationToken)
{
var columnCount = routine.ColumnCount;
var fileName = routine.Name.Trim('"').Replace('/', '_');
if (customParameters is not null && customParameters.TryGetValue("excel_file_name", out var customFileName))
{
fileName = customFileName;
if (!fileName.EndsWith(".xlsx", StringComparison.OrdinalIgnoreCase))
{
fileName += ".xlsx";
}
}
else
{
fileName += ".xlsx";
}
context.Response.Headers["Content-Disposition"] = $"attachment; filename=\"{fileName}\"";
var stream = writer.AsStream(leaveOpen: true);
SpreadCheetahOptions? options = DateTimeFormat is not null
? new SpreadCheetahOptions { DefaultDateTimeFormat = NumberFormat.Custom(DateTimeFormat) }
: null;
await using var spreadsheet = await Spreadsheet.CreateNewAsync(stream, options, cancellationToken);
var headerStyle = spreadsheet.AddStyle(new Style { Font = { Bold = true } });
var sheetName = SheetName ?? routine.Name.Trim('"');
if (customParameters is not null && customParameters.TryGetValue("excel_sheet", out var customSheetName))
{
sheetName = customSheetName;
}
if (sheetName.Length > 31)
{
sheetName = sheetName[..31];
}
await spreadsheet.StartWorksheetAsync(sheetName, token: cancellationToken);
await spreadsheet.AddHeaderRowAsync(routine.ColumnNames, headerStyle, cancellationToken);
var descriptors = routine.ColumnsTypeDescriptor;
if (NumericFormat is not null)
{
var numericStyle = spreadsheet.AddStyle(new Style { Format = NumberFormat.Custom(NumericFormat) });
await WriteStyledRowsAsync(spreadsheet, reader, columnCount, descriptors, numericStyle, cancellationToken);
}
else
{
await WriteDataRowsAsync(spreadsheet, reader, columnCount, descriptors, cancellationToken);
}
await spreadsheet.FinishAsync(cancellationToken);
}
private static async Task WriteDataRowsAsync(
Spreadsheet spreadsheet,
NpgsqlDataReader reader,
int columnCount,
TypeDescriptor[] descriptors,
CancellationToken cancellationToken)
{
var cells = new DataCell[columnCount];
while (await reader.ReadAsync(cancellationToken))
{
for (int i = 0; i < columnCount; i++)
{
if (reader.IsDBNull(i))
{
cells[i] = default;
continue;
}
var value = reader.GetValue(i);
cells[i] = value switch
{
int v => new DataCell(v),
long v => new DataCell(v),
double v => new DataCell(v),
float v => new DataCell(v),
decimal v => new DataCell(v),
bool v => new DataCell(v),
DateTime v => new DataCell(v),
string s => ParseStringCell(s, descriptors[i]),
_ => new DataCell(value.ToString() ?? "")
};
}
await spreadsheet.AddRowAsync(cells, cancellationToken);
}
}
private static async Task WriteStyledRowsAsync(
Spreadsheet spreadsheet,
NpgsqlDataReader reader,
int columnCount,
TypeDescriptor[] descriptors,
StyleId numericStyle,
CancellationToken cancellationToken)
{
var cells = new Cell[columnCount];
while (await reader.ReadAsync(cancellationToken))
{
for (int i = 0; i < columnCount; i++)
{
if (reader.IsDBNull(i))
{
cells[i] = default;
continue;
}
var value = reader.GetValue(i);
var dataCell = value switch
{
int v => new DataCell(v),
long v => new DataCell(v),
double v => new DataCell(v),
float v => new DataCell(v),
decimal v => new DataCell(v),
bool v => new DataCell(v),
DateTime v => new DataCell(v),
string s => ParseStringCell(s, descriptors[i]),
_ => new DataCell(value.ToString() ?? "")
};
cells[i] = IsNumericValue(value, descriptors[i])
? new Cell(dataCell, numericStyle)
: new Cell(dataCell);
}
await spreadsheet.AddRowAsync(cells, cancellationToken);
}
}
private static bool IsNumericValue(object value, TypeDescriptor descriptor) =>
value is int or long or double or float or decimal
|| (value is string && descriptor.IsNumeric);
private static DataCell ParseStringCell(string value, TypeDescriptor descriptor)
{
if (descriptor.IsNumeric && double.TryParse(value, CultureInfo.InvariantCulture, out var d))
{
return new DataCell(d);
}
if (descriptor.IsBoolean)
{
if (bool.TryParse(value, out var b))
{
return new DataCell(b);
}
// PostgreSQL text representation: "t"/"f"
if (string.Equals(value, "t", StringComparison.OrdinalIgnoreCase))
{
return new DataCell(true);
}
if (string.Equals(value, "f", StringComparison.OrdinalIgnoreCase))
{
return new DataCell(false);
}
}
if ((descriptor.IsDateTime || descriptor.IsDate) && DateTime.TryParse(value, CultureInfo.InvariantCulture, DateTimeStyles.None, out var dt))
{
return new DataCell(dt);
}
return new DataCell(value);
}
}
